Guaranteeing Conformity with the Registered Representative
The designated registered representative plays an essential function in maintaining the lawful integrity of a signed up entity by functioning as the official point of contact for state interactions, lawful notifications, and compliance commitments. This representative needs to be available during normal company hours and possess a physical address within the state where the entity is registered, making sure timely invoice of important records. Their duties encompass getting service of procedure, lawful summons, and main correspondence, which they are mandated to forward to the suitable people within the organization in a timely fashion. Having a reliable registered agent helps the company abide by legal needs, stay clear of penalties, and guarantee that legal notices are not missed out on, which might or else lead to fail judgments or management dissolution. The representative's get in touch with details is publicly taped and stays easily accessible to federal government agencies, lawful entities, and the public, fostering openness and responsibility. Additionally, selecting a qualified agent help in keeping good standing with state authorities, stopping issues associated with non-compliance or missed out on target dates. Regular updates and verification of the agent's contact information are vital to sustain compliance and promote reliable legal and management communications for the registered entity.
